Women's Tennis Swept By Luther

Sep 10, 2019

DECORAH, Iowa - The University of Dubuque women's tennis team began American Rivers Conference action on Tuesday night, getting swept by the Luther College Norse in Decorah, 9-0.

Three different Spartans won a set in singles play against the Norse, led by Samantha Heins who won two sets in the four spot. Ashley Palacious in the one spot and Hailey Wang at three, each won one set.

The Spartans return to the court on Saturday when they host Nebraska Wesleyan at 9 a.m. and Buena Vista at 12 p.m.
